Yamaha Banshee 350 Top Speed : How Rapid Can It Truly Go?
The famed Yamaha Banshee 350 enjoys a notoriety for being incredibly speedy , but what's its actual top rate? Generally , a stock Banshee 350, with its original gearing and setup, can reach a highest speed of around 58 kilometers per hour on a smooth surface. However, this figure is highly variable based on factors like rubber condition, altitude, rider weight, and any modifications made to the ATV . With aftermarket modifications like muffler systems, reeds, and altered gearing, some riders have reportedly pushed the machine to speeds going beyond 75 mph , making it a truly exciting ride.

Typical Problems & Maintenance for Your Yamaha 350 Banshee
Owning a legendary Yamaha 350 presents special rewards, but also a few difficulties. Often encountered issues include damaged reed valves, failing crank seals, and difficulties with the fuel system. Consistent care is vital to maintaining your quad's condition. This involves periodic inspections of the transmission, breather, and spark plugs. Do not ignoring fluid changes, and consider upgrading pieces like the radiator for better performance. Addressing such areas proactively will assist you to experience extended and trustworthy riding adventure.
